WASHINGTON— U.S. Senators Lindsey Graham (R-South Carolina), John McCain (R-Arizona) and Kelly Ayotte (R-New Hampshire) today called on President Obama to release the names of the Benghazi survivors.
“In light of your comments yesterday about the Benghazi attacks, we again request your Administration immediately provide the names of the Benghazi survivors to Congress so we can conduct interviews to gain a clearer understanding of what happened before, during, and after the attack.
“This information will allow Congress to meet its oversight obligations and will help ensure our government is taking the proper steps to protect American lives abroad and prevent future terrorist attacks.”

Dear President Obama:
In light of your comments yesterday about the Benghazi attacks, we again request your Administration immediately provide the names of the Benghazi survivors to Congress so we can conduct interviews to gain a clearer understanding of what happened before, during, and after the attack.
This information will allow Congress to meet its oversight obligations and will help ensure our government is taking the proper steps to protect American lives abroad and prevent future terrorist attacks.
Please ensure these names are provided to the appropriate committee(s) for possible interviews and correspondence. While we respect that the names of certain survivors may need to be kept confidential, we’re confident any privacy or national security concerns will be addressed by the appropriate committee(s).
Thank you for your assistance with this important matter.
